"DM9000的中文数据手册提供了全面的关于DM9000A网络芯片的信息,包括概述、模块图、特性、引脚配置及其描述、控制和状态寄存器列表等,旨在帮助用户更好地理解和使用该芯片。" DM9000是一款广泛应用的网络接口芯片,因其高速、稳定和高可靠性而受到青睐。本中文数据手册详细介绍了DM9000A的各项功能和操作方法,涵盖了以下几个核心知识点: 1. **概述**:这部分通常会介绍DM9000A的基本功能,可能包括其支持的网络协议(如Ethernet)、传输速度(10/100Mbps)以及其在硬件系统中的作用。 2. **模块图**:模块图展示了DM9000A的内部架构,包括处理器接口、PHY接口、内存管理单元等,帮助用户理解芯片各部分如何协同工作。 3. **特性**:特性列表列举了DM9000A的主要优点,例如集成的PHY层支持、自动协商能力、全双工通信、流控制机制等。 4. **引脚配置**:分为16位和8位两种模式,详细列出了每个引脚的功能,包括数据线、控制线、时钟线、电源线和接地线等,这对于电路设计和连接至关重要。 5. **引脚描述**:详细解释了每个引脚的作用,如处理器接口的DQ、DQS、CS等,EEPROM接口的I2C线,时钟引脚的CLK,LED接口用于状态指示,以及与PHY接口相关的信号。 6. **控制和状态寄存器**:这部分列出了一系列的控制和状态寄存器,如网络控制寄存器(NCR)用于设置工作模式,网络状态寄存器(NSR)反映芯片当前的工作状态。这些寄存器是编程和调试的关键,通过读写它们可以改变DM9000A的行为。 - **发送和接收控制寄存器(TCR, RCR)**:控制数据发送和接收的参数,如帧过滤、自动填充、回送模式等。 - **状态寄存器(TSRI, TSRII, RSR, ROCR)**:提供发送和接收过程的状态信息,如发送完成、接收错误等。 - **流控寄存器(BPTR, FCTR, RTFCR)**:管理数据流量,防止网络拥塞。 - **MAC地址寄存器(PAR)**:存储设备的物理(MAC)地址,用于网络识别。 - **多播地址寄存器(MAR)**:用于多播地址过滤。 - **EEPROM和PHY控制寄存器(EPCR, EPAR, EPDRL/EPDRH)**:与外部EEPROM交互,存储配置信息,并控制PHY的操作。 7. **其他寄存器**:如WCR唤醒控制寄存器,GPCR通用目的控制寄存器,GPR通用目的寄存器等,提供了额外的控制选项和状态信息。 了解这些详细信息后,开发者能够有效地利用DM9000A在网络接口设计中实现高效的数据传输,并能根据具体需求进行配置和优化。这个中文数据手册为学习和使用DM9000A芯片提供了宝贵的参考材料。
剩余50页未读,继续阅读